Inspiren Welcomes Brian Geyser as Head of Clinical Innovation
Inspiren, a trailblazer in AI solutions aimed at transforming senior living, has made a pivotal addition to its leadership team with the appointment of Brian Geyser as Head of Clinical Innovation. Geyser, who has a robust track record in healthcare innovation and operations spanning over three decades, is expected to significantly advance the company’s efforts in integrating real-time clinical intelligence into its services.

“My decision to join Inspiren stems from my longstanding belief in its mission, technology, and people,” Geyser commented. “As AI technology is set to revolutionize the realms of senior and post-acute care, I am excited to contribute to a team that is uniquely positioned to drive impactful change.”
This appointment aligns with Inspiren’s broader initiative of deepening its clinical and operational strategies, a move bolstered by significant increases in their product and engineering investments over the past year. Geyser previously served as the Vice President of Enterprise Intelligence at Maplewood Senior Living, where he implemented AI solutions that notably improved staff efficiency and resident satisfaction.
